🍴 Ingredients & Preparation
Chefs prepare the Ranger Meal – Ranger Rib Basket by slow-cooking pork ribs until tender. Then, they grill the ribs and coat them in the restaurant’s signature barbecue sauce, locking in smoky sweetness. Finally, the ribs are served with a kid-friendly side such as fries, mashed potatoes, or applesauce to complete the meal.

🚨 Allergen Information
The Ranger Rib Basket is flavorful but may contain allergens depending on preparation.
Allergen | Presence / Risk |
---|---|
Gluten | Possible in barbecue sauce or sides |
Dairy | Present in mashed potatoes or sauces |
Soy | Possible in barbecue sauce |
Onion/Garlic | Common in seasoning and sauce |
📊 Nutritional Information
The Ranger Rib Basket offers a hearty serving of smoky ribs in a kid-sized portion.
Portion | Calories | Protein | Fat | Sodium |
---|---|---|---|---|
Ranger Rib Basket (with side) | ~500 – 650 kcal | ~22 g | ~28 g | ~1,100 mg |
Values vary depending on sides and sauces.
